**Q: How does the Tariffa rules engine evaluate my plugin's shipping-fee rules?**

Tariffa evaluates rules in priority order, highest first, and stops at the first matching rule unless your plugin declares `cumulative: true` in its manifest. Plugins may not override the carrier surcharge tier, which Tariffa applies after all plugin rules complete. Test against the sandbox catalog before submitting. If your rule produces unexpected totals in sandbox, capture the evaluation trace and send it to the plugin support team at the address below.

pager mailbox: druwyn@norvaio.corp

Subject: Quickstore 4.2 — bloom filter now fronts the KV layer

Plugin authors: starting with this release, Quickstore places a bloom filter ahead of the key-value store. Negative lookups return faster; false positives fall through safely. No API changes are required on your side. Verify your plugin against the staging build referenced below.

session token of fahif-tadup = htk3_9c7

# Stormcast Artifact Signing

Stormcast fans out weather alerts to regional relays, so tampered builds are a real risk. Every release artifact is signed; relays verify before loading. Rules: sign only CI-produced builds, never local ones. Rotate keys quarterly. Revoke immediately if a build host is compromised. Signature checks are enforced at relay startup — an unsigned binary will not boot. New team members should import and trust the current release key, which appears below.

deploy key for kajof-fajop: bky6_gDHw9Q

Ticket: FIELD-2281 — Expired credentials blocking offline sync

For the weekly sync: the Heronpath field-survey app's offline mode stopped reconciling on Monday because the cached sync token expired while crews were out of coverage. Surveys queued locally are intact, but uploads fail silently until re-auth. We've extended token lifetime to 30 days and reissued credentials. The replacement key for the internal sync service follows.

service key, fafog-fahaf: vxb3-x55